Keanu Reeves’ Dogstar Announce New Album All In Now and 2026 World Tour
Rock trio Dogstar, featuring actor and bassist Keanu Reeves, have officially announced their upcoming album All In Now, arriving May 29, 2026 via the band’s own label Dillon Street Records. Alongside the announcement, the band also revealed an extensive 2026 world tour that will bring them across North America and Europe, including a stop in Atlanta at the Tabernacle on August 4.

Remembering the Spaceman: Ace Frehley (1951–2025)
The rock world was shaken midday on October 16, 2025, by heartbreaking news: Ace Frehley, original lead guitarist and cofounder of Kiss, has died at the age of 74. His passing was confirmed in a statement from his family and representatives, citing complications from a recent fall in his home studio that led to a brain injury.
